2016-2018 Volvo V90 () 2.0 D4 (190 Hp) AWD Automatic

The Volvo V90, introduced in 2016, represents Volvo’s entry into the premium mid-size wagon segment. Positioned above the V60, the V90 aimed to combine practicality, luxury, and Scandinavian design. Built on Volvo’s Scalable Product Architecture (SPA) platform, it shares its underpinnings with the XC90 and S90. The V90 was primarily marketed in Europe and other international markets, offering a sophisticated alternative to more conventional SUVs and sedans. This article details the 2016-2018 V90 equipped with the 2.0 D4 AWD Automatic powertrain.

Engine & Performance

At the heart of the V90 D4 lies a 2.0-liter inline four-cylinder diesel engine, designated D4204T14. This engine produces 190 horsepower at 4,250 rpm and 400 Newton-meters (295 lb-ft) of torque between 1,740 and 2,520 rpm. The engine utilizes twin-turbocharging and an intercooler to optimize power delivery and efficiency. The engine’s transverse mounting and commonrail direct fuel injection system contribute to its responsiveness and reduced emissions. The V90 D4 achieves a 0-100 km/h (0-62 mph) acceleration time of 8.7 seconds, and a 0-60 mph time of 8.3 seconds. Its maximum speed is electronically limited to 225 km/h (139.81 mph). Fuel economy is rated at 4.9 liters per 100 kilometers (48 US mpg, 57.6 UK mpg), with CO2 emissions of 128 g/km, meeting Euro 6 emission standards.

Design & Features

The Volvo V90 boasts a sleek and elegant station wagon (estate) body style, characterized by its long roofline and sculpted surfaces. The design emphasizes Scandinavian minimalism, with clean lines and a focus on functionality. The V90 offers seating for five passengers and features five doors for easy access. Key features include a spacious interior, a premium infotainment system, and a range of advanced safety technologies. The trunk offers a minimum capacity of 560 liters (19.78 cu ft), expanding to 1,526 liters (53.89 cu ft) with the rear seats folded down. Safety features were a core tenet of Volvo’s design philosophy, and the V90 included systems like ABS (Anti-lock Braking System) and a comprehensive suite of driver-assistance technologies. The vehicle’s drag coefficient ranges from 0.30 to 0.33, contributing to improved aerodynamic efficiency.

Technical Specifications

Brand Volvo
Model V90
Generation V90 (2016)
Type (Engine) 2.0 D4 (190 Hp) AWD Automatic
Start of production 2016
End of production 2018
Powertrain Architecture Internal Combustion engine
Body type Station wagon (estate)
Seats 5
Doors 5
Fuel consumption (combined) 4.9 l/100 km (48 US mpg, 57.6 UK mpg, 20.4 km/l)
CO2 emissions 128 g/km
Fuel Type Diesel
Acceleration 0 – 100 km/h 8.7 sec
Acceleration 0 – 62 mph 8.7 sec
Acceleration 0 – 60 mph 8.3 sec
Maximum speed 225 km/h (139.81 mph)
Power 190 Hp @ 4250 rpm
Torque 400 Nm @ 1740-2520 rpm (295.02 lb.-ft. @ 1740-2520 rpm)
Maximum engine speed 5000 rpm
Engine layout Front, Transverse
Engine Model/Code D4204T14
Engine displacement 1969 cm3 (120.16 cu. in.)
Number of cylinders 4
Engine configuration Inline
Cylinder Bore 82 mm (3.23 in.)
Piston Stroke 93.2 mm (3.67 in.)
Compression ratio 15.8:1
Number of valves per cylinder 4
Fuel injection system Diesel Commonrail
Engine aspiration Twin-Turbo, Intercooler
Valvetrain DOHC
Engine oil capacity 5.2 l (5.49 US qt | 4.58 UK qt)
Trunk (boot) space – minimum 560 l (19.78 cu. ft.)
Trunk (boot) space – maximum 1526 l (53.89 cu. ft.)
Fuel tank capacity 60 l (15.85 US gal | 13.2 UK gal)
Permitted trailer load with brakes (12%) 1800 kg (3968.32 lbs.)
Permitted trailer load without brakes 750 kg (1653.47 lbs.)
Length 4936 mm (194.33 in.)
Width 1879 mm (73.98 in.)
Width with mirrors folded 1895 mm (74.61 in.)
Width including mirrors 2019 mm (79.49 in.)
Height 1475 mm (58.07 in.)
Wheelbase 2941 mm (115.79 in.)
Front track 1617-1628 mm (63.66 – 64.09 in.)
Rear (Back) track 1618-1629 mm (63.7 – 64.13 in.)
Ride height (ground clearance) 153 mm (6.02 in.)
Drag coefficient (Cd) 0.30-0.33
Minimum turning circle (turning diameter) 12.2 m (40.03 ft.)
Drive wheel All wheel drive (4×4)
Number of gears and type of gearbox 8 gears, automatic transmission
Front suspension Double wishbone
Rear suspension Independent multi-link spring suspension with stabilizer
Front brakes Ventilated discs
Rear brakes Disc
Steering type Steering rack and pinion
Power steering Electric Steering
Tires size 245/45 R18
Wheel rims size 18
